Chris Clemenza (born September 30, 1998) in New Jersey is an American record executive and manager. Chris has been actively involved in hip hop developing talent for 5 years. He started by managing rappers Young King Dave and Squidnice[1] then later co founded record label Nice Entertainment signing popular young talent Bobbynice in 2018.[2] After discovering Bobbynice, Chris signed New York's 18 year old rapper Smaccnice expanding the roster of the early record company.[3] Later in 2019, Chris launched the record label's recording studio Nice Ent Studio and made appearances for Vice, XXL, and Rolling Loud alongside his artist Squidnice.[4]
